Spyro 1's art direction and world design carried a surreality that you just didn't get with the next entries. Enemies were so abstract that your head filled in the gaps, and not stopping and talking to NPCs for sidequests and crap meant the level had a continuous flow to it. Also the UI was so much better than the .pngs used in the next two entries.
